## Runbook: Reset Flow Revamp — Release Step 4

The revamped password reset flow for Kestrelgate ships as a signed bundle, same as any auth-path change. After the canary checks pass, promote the bundle to the staging registry. The registry rejects unsigned pushes, so confirm your signing setup before starting. Promotion must use the team release key, reproduced here for convenience.

release key, yagap-kagag: bky6_1ks93y

Handover — Gridfall crossword generator

State: generator healthy, nightly puzzle batch runs at 02:00. Known issue: the clue-dedup pass sometimes stalls on themed grids; kill and rerun, it's idempotent. Dictionary updates land Fridays — don't deploy midweek. The solver-validation queue backs up if the worker pool drops below three; scale it manually. Admin console is sealed after my offboarding; to regain maintenance access you'll need to unseal it with the recovery passphrase below.

vault phrase of yagag-kadup = belael-druius-rusax-kelox

## Deployment

FareLab is our ticket-pricing experiment service, and plugin authors can run it locally without much fuss. Grab the latest image, point it at a scratch database, and it'll seed a demo experiment on first boot. Plugins load from the extensions directory automatically — no restart needed. One heads-up: price variants won't activate until the experiment flag is on. Local runs expect the following configuration.

service settings:
PRAIX_LOG_LEVEL=error
PRAIX_METRICS_HOST=metrics.praix.qorvelcorp.corp
PRAIX_POOL_SIZE=16

### 2.9.0 — Renamed `SYNC_CLASH_MODE` to `MELLOWCAL_CONFLICT_POLICY`

The old name predated the merge of the Driftbook scheduler into MellowCal and no longer described its scope, since the setting now governs both overlapping-event detection and attendee reconciliation. Migration is automatic, but the conflict resolver's credential must be redeclared manually because the prefix changed. Add this line to your environment file before restarting the sync daemon:

secret setting of bajeg-yahog: LEDGER_TOKEN20=f833f3e2e6625ec0dee3